Cannabiz co-founders Martin Lane and Kim McKay are joined by editor-at-large Rhys Cohen to review the latest happenings in cannabis, including:
- The Dean of the Faculty of Pain Medicine’s anti-cannabis rant
- How the industry should respond to PR crises
- Kim’s vision for Women in Cannabis
- New York’s plans for legalisation
